The Digital Imaging market within the context of Hardware is a rapidly growing industry. It encompasses a wide range of products, from digital cameras and scanners to digital photo frames and printers. Digital imaging technology has revolutionized the way people capture, store, and share images. It has enabled users to take high-quality photos and videos with ease, and to share them with friends and family.
Digital imaging hardware is used in a variety of industries, from professional photography to medical imaging. It is also used in consumer electronics, such as smartphones and tablets. Digital imaging hardware is becoming increasingly sophisticated, with features such as high-resolution sensors, advanced image processing, and improved connectivity.
Some of the major players in the Digital Imaging market include Canon, Nikon, Sony, Fujifilm, Olympus, Panasonic, and Samsung. These companies offer a wide range of products, from digital cameras and lenses to scanners and printers.
